Re: Rock Rey Aftermarket Thread My son (12yo) and I have been bashing a stock rock rey for 2 weeks now. I did replace the steering servo and arm before I even drove it, but other than that, it's been great. Took the body off today for a light inspection and found the front shock tower broken in three places, and the front cage near the shock tower broken on one side. I removed the parts, drilled 1/16" holes in both sides of the breaks, and glued pieces of heavy paper clips to effectively pin the parts together until I can order more. Worked perfectly. With how much we have cart-wheeled and flipped this truck, I'm stunned that is all that we broke. I am very impressed with it so far. Sent from my SM-G955U using Tapatalk |
